The issue is still happening this morning, and I’m fairly certain it’s a glitch on Amazon’s end. I’ve only had a few actual orders this morning since it’s still early, but the Amazon Seller App summary screen is showing exactly double the number of orders and revenue compared to what’s showing in STK.

Interestingly, if I go into the Orders screen in the Amazon app, it reflects the real number of orders, same as STK, so clearly the summary data is off. I’ve reported it to Amazon, but I’m wondering if anyone else is experiencing this right now (or has in the past). A bit concerned it might affect payouts or referral fee calculations.

Yes, this type of discrepancy between the Amazon Seller App summary screen and actual order data has happened before and is usually just a temporary display glitch on Amazon’s end, it doesn’t typically affect payouts or referral fee calculations since those are based on actual order-level data, not the summary dashboard. If the Orders screen and your STK data match, that’s a good sign that your real figures are intact. It’s still a good move that you reported it to Amazon, but you can expect it to resolve on its own without impacting your financials or account metrics.
